A partnership between Dan Dower & Anna Campbell-Jones Dan and I first spoke about swallows when I told him about the ones I’d created from recycled Scottish ocean plastic – delicate little wall ornaments born from the debris our seas give back to us. We talked about their symbolism, their beauty, and the way they always seem to find their way home. It wasn’t long before we knew we wanted to create a version you could wear close to your heart.

There’s something magical about swallows: they mate for life, never stray far from land, and carry with them a quiet promise of return. For centuries, sailors inked them into their skin after thousands of nautical miles – badges of courage and skill hard-won on wild seas. I’ve always loved the old saying:

“Calm seas never made a skilled sailor.”

Our Swallow Talisman holds all of that meaning. It’s a little piece of your journey, whether you wear it as a reminder of where you’ve been, a wish for safe return, or a gift of love and loyalty.
